The Influence on Landscapes

Climate shifts are profoundly reshaping terrain across the globe. Rising temperatures are accelerating ice melt, causing dramatic withdrawal of mountain fields and a subsequent growth in sea level. Beach zones more info are facing more erosion and submersion, endangering ecosystems and human communities. Furthermore, altered moisture patterns are contributing more frequent and powerful dry spells in some locations, while various zones are seeing more extreme wet periods. These shifts and also influence the appearance of the world, but also present a serious threat to biodiversity and people's prosperity.

The History and Development of Scenic Art

From antiquity, depictions of nature have existed, but landscape art as a distinct genre truly emerged during the 15th century . Initially, backgrounds in religious or portrait paintings served as incidental elements, showcasing some depth and atmosphere. The 17th century witnessed a growing appreciation for the outdoors , particularly in the Lowland tradition and the UK, leading to increasingly detailed and focused portrayals of plains, woodlands , and hills . The 1800s era further elevated landscape painting, emphasizing sentiment and the magnificent power of the environment. Contemporary artists have expanded the boundaries, challenging new methods and perspectives, from hazy renderings to conceptual interpretations of our splendor .
